2011-08-15 9 views
3

페이지의 헤드 섹션에이 메타 태그를 추가해야 IE7을 강제 실행하는 페이지가 필요합니다.jquery를 통해 메타 태그 추가 중?

<meta http-equiv="X-UA-Compatible" content="IE=EmulateIE7" /> 

나는 내가이 작업을 수행 할 수있는 방법

DNN 5.6을 사용하고 있습니다?

+4

IE를 동적으로 추가 할 경우 IE가 이에 대해 반응할지 확신 할 수 없습니다. 서버 측에 추가하지 않으시겠습니까? –

답변

22

$('head').append('<meta http-equiv="X-UA-Compatible" content="IE=EmulateIE7" /> ');

나는 확실하지 않다 비록 그것이 생성 될 것이다 페이지가

로드 된 후 영향을해야합니다 - 추가 할 경우

- 편집 페이지 설명을위한 메타 데이터 태그를 사용하려면 DNN 페이지의 설정을 사용하여 설명 및 키워드를 추가하십시오. 을 초과하면 HEAD를 수정할 때 가장 좋은 방법은 동적으로 코드를 타사 모듈을 통해 HEAD에 삽입하는 것입니다.

운이 좋다면이 다른 메타 태그를 허용 할 수 http://www.dotnetnuke.com/Resources/Forums/forumid/7/threadid/298385/scope/posts.aspx

에서 찾을 수 - 편집 2 -

추가 HEAD 태그는 페이지 설정에 배치 할 수 있습니다 > 고급 설정> 페이지 헤더 태그.

는 페이지가로드 된 후 <meta> 헤더를 추가하는 아무 소용이 정말 없다 http://www.dotnetnuke.com/Resources/Forums/forumid/-1/postid/223250/scope/posts.aspx

+0

이것은 보입니다. – Saul

+1

잘하면! 정보를 위해, 나는 'dotnetnuke head add meta'에 대한 Google 검색에서 이것을 찾았습니다. –

2

에서 발견.

강제로 IE7 렌더링을 사용하려면 기본 HTML을 변경하십시오.

+0

어떻게 스킨 파일을 ie7을로드하도록 강제합니까? – PD24

+0

@ PD24 : "피부"와 "부하 ie7"이 무슨 뜻인지 모르겠습니다. – Saul

+0

@ PD24 : 필자가 생각할 수있는 것으로 내 대답을 업데이트했습니다. –

관련 문제